Dan and Laura Dotson: The Auctioneering Power Couple
At the heart of every Storage Wars auction were Dan and Laura Dotson, the fast-talking, no-nonsense auctioneering duo who kept the bidding fast and the bidders on their toes. Their signature catchphrases and dynamic partnership made them the unsung heroes of the show, the conductors of the chaotic orchestra of treasure hunting. For 14 seasons, they were a constant presence, their professional yet personable approach setting the stage for the drama and excitement that would unfold. When the show went on hiatus, the Dotsons didn’t miss a beat. They seamlessly transitioned back into their pre-reality TV lives, continuing to do what they do best: auctioneering. Their business, American Auctioneers, has thrived, and they’ve expanded their empire with the creation of storageauctions.net, a testament to their entrepreneurial spirit and enduring passion for the industry. They are a shining example of how to leverage reality TV fame into long-term, sustainable success.
Mark Ballelo: A Tragic End for “Rico Suave”
Mark Ballelo, known to fans as “Rico Suave,” was a whirlwind of energy and confidence. His flamboyant style and larger-than-life personality made him a memorable, if not polarizing, figure on the show. He was a man who played by his own rules, a true maverick in the world of storage auctions. But beneath the confident exterior was a man battling his own demons. In 2013, the Storage Wars community was rocked by the news of his passing at the tragically young age of 40. His death was ruled a suicide, a shocking and heartbreaking end for a man who seemed to have it all. Ballelo was not just a reality TV star; he was a businessman, the owner of Bolo Inc., a gaming store, and an auction house. His death served as a stark reminder of the hidden struggles that can lie beneath a public persona, a tragic loss that is still felt by fans of the show.
Daryl Sheets: The Gambler’s Final Bet
Daryl Sheets, “the gambler,” was the embodiment of the Storage Wars spirit. With his optimistic attitude and willingness to take a risk, he was a fan favorite, a man who was always chasing the next big score. After his time on the show, Sheets embarked on a personal journey of transformation, focusing on his health and losing a significant amount of weight. But his biggest gamble would be with his own health. In 2019, he suffered a severe heart attack, which led to congestive heart failure and subsequent heart surgery. For a time, it seemed as though “the gambler” had beaten the odds once again. But in March 2023, the news that fans had been dreading was confirmed: Daryl Sheets had passed away. His death marked the end of an era for Storage Wars fans, a final, poignant reminder of the man who always believed that the next locker held the treasure of a lifetime.
Brandon Sheets: From “The Side Bet” to a New Life
Following in his father’s footsteps was Brandon Sheets, “the side bet.” He brought a youthful energy to the show, a more measured and analytical approach that often clashed with his father’s gung-ho style. Their dynamic was a central part of the show’s appeal, a classic tale of the old school versus the new. In 2016, Brandon left the show due to budget cuts, a move that disappointed many fans. But he didn’t let this setback define him. He relocated to Arizona and carved out a new path for himself, becoming a successful real estate agent and logistics specialist. In June 2024, he faced another challenge, surviving a serious car accident. Brandon’s journey is a story of resilience, of a young man who stepped out of his father’s shadow and created his own success, on his own terms.
Barry Weiss: The Collector’s Unorthodox Journey
Perhaps no cast member was as unique or as beloved as Barry Weiss, “the collector.” With his eccentric style, unorthodox bidding methods, and seemingly endless collection of bizarre and wonderful items, he was the show’s resident wildcard. He left the show in 2015, but his legacy lived on. He was so popular that he was given two spin-off shows, Buried Treasure and Storage Wars: Barry Strikes Back. In 2019, his life took a dramatic turn when he was involved in a serious motorcycle accident. But in true Barry Weiss fashion, he made a full recovery, his indomitable spirit shining through. He has since become the face of Sherwood Valley Casino, a fitting role for a man who has always been a master of the unexpected.
Ivy Calvin: The King of Palmdale’s Enduring Reign
Ivy Calvin, a retired footballer and MMA fighter, brought a quiet intensity to the show. Known as “the King of Palmdale,” he joined the main cast in season 5, quickly establishing himself as a serious contender. After the show, he focused on his thrift store, Grandma’s Attic, in Palmdale, California. The store, a treasure trove of unique and interesting finds, became a destination for fans and bargain hunters alike. In recent years, Grandma’s Attic has transitioned to an online sales model with limited weekend openings, a savvy business move that reflects Calvin’s astute and adaptable nature.
Renee and Casey Nezhoda: The Bargain-Hunting Duo
Renee and Casey Nezhoda, the husband-and-wife team who joined the show in season 4, were an instant hit. Their expert knowledge of secondhand sales, combined with their humorous and often chaotic dynamic, made them fan favorites. They were so popular that they were brought back when the show was revived in 2021. They have also successfully parlayed their TV fame into a thriving online presence, with a popular YouTube channel, “Bargain Hunters Thrift.” While their physical store closed in 2023, their online business continues to flourish, and they are reportedly still happily married, a rare and refreshing story in the often-tumultuous world of reality TV.
Brandi Passante and Jarrod Schulz: A Power Couple’s Public Breakup
Brandi Passante and Jarrod Schulz were the show’s resident power couple, their intense bickering and fearless bidding a central part of the show’s drama. They even had their own spin-off, Brandi and Jarrod: Married to the Job. But the on-screen tension was a reflection of a deeper, more personal struggle. After filming season 12, the couple broke up, with the news not being made public until 2021. The split was a shock to many fans who had followed their journey for years. Brandi has since moved on, embracing her status as a single mother and finding love with a new partner. Their story is a poignant reminder that the lines between reality and television can often be blurred, with real-life consequences that extend far beyond the final credits.
Dave Hester: The Villain’s Quiet Retirement
Every good story needs a villain, and in the world of Storage Wars, that role was filled by Dave Hester. With his aggressive bidding style and his infamous catchphrase, “Yuuup!”, he was the man that everyone loved to hate. But Hester’s time on the show was not without controversy. He was kicked off the show after publicly stating that it was scripted, a move that sent shockwaves through the reality TV world. He later opened his own independent auctioneering business, but has since semi-retired, opting for a quieter life in Alaska with his family. He has also faced his own health battles, surviving a hemorrhagic stroke. The “Mogul” may have faded from the spotlight, but his impact on the show is undeniable.
Mary Padian: The Junkyard Queen’s Charitable Heart
Mary Padian, “the junkster” and “the junkyard queen,” brought a fresh and artistic perspective to the show. She joined the main cast in season 5 after a stint on Storage Wars Texas, her infectious enthusiasm and creative eye for turning trash into treasure making her an instant fan favorite. She is the owner of Mary’s Finds, a vintage store that has successfully transitioned to an online platform after closing its physical doors due to the COVID-19 pandemic. But Padian is more than just a savvy businesswoman; she is also a philanthropist, actively involved with Ubuntu Life, a charitable organization that assists children with special needs in Kenya. Her story is one of passion, purpose, and a commitment to making the world a more beautiful place, one find at a time.
